Customization and Versatility
Customization is a significant advantage of the Luthier Guitar Fretboard. It is unslotted and unfinished, allowing builders to personalize scale lengths and fret positions to their liking. This flexibility is invaluable for luthiers looking to create a unique instrument that meets specific requirements. In contrast, the Pyle Beginner Acoustic Guitar Kit is a complete instrument that comes pre-assembled, which limits the ability to customize. While the Pyle kit is ready to play, it lacks the versatility that the Luthier Guitar Fretboard offers.
